Alpelisib (BYL-719) is an orally active PI3Kα -selective inhibitor that blocks the conversion of PIP2 to PIP3 , thereby inhibiting pathways including PI3K/AKT/mTOR , MAPK/ERK , Notch and JAK-STAT . Alpelisib also induces apoptosis , G0/G1 phase arrest and senescence; it significantly inhibits the proliferation, self-renewal, stemness and epithelial-mesenchymal transition (EMT) of tumor cells, reduces cancer stem cell populations and decreases the expression of stem cell markers. Alpelisib not only enhances the sensitivity to Eribulin ( HY-13442 ) and exerts a synergistic effect with Paclitaxel ( HY-B0015 ), but may also induce drug resistance by upregulating the SGK3/GSK3β/β-catenin signaling pathway. Alpelisib can be applied to research related to breast cancer , gastric cancer and lipomas associated with PTEN hamartoma tumor syndrome.
